40 years of Cicor Microtech AG – Autumn festival with anniversary celebrations

On 19 September, Cicor Microtech AG was finally able to hold its autumn festival, which had to be postponed last year, and at the same time celebrated its 40th anniversary.

In glorious weather, employees, families and friends enjoyed an atmospheric day full of fun and fellowship. A food truck treated guests to delicious delicacies, while a local musician provided the perfect musical accompaniment.

A wheelbarrow race and a tricky quiz also provided excellent entertainment, ensuring plenty of fun and laughter among the participants.

The belated autumn festival was a complete success and provided the perfect setting to celebrate 40 years of Cicor Microtech AG in style – with gratitude, team spirit and joy in shared success.

New name, same strength – Reinhardt Microtech AG becomes Cicor Microtech AG

On 17 October, Reinhardt Microtech AG took an important step in its corporate history: to strengthen its affiliation and connection to the Group, the company name was officially changed to Cicor Microtech AG.

This name change underscores our close cooperation within the Group family and our shared focus on innovation, quality and sustainable success.

For our employees and customers, nothing will change in terms of our usual partnership – the same people, the same passion and the same reliability will continue to be at the heart of what we do.

The new name symbolises what defines us: cohesion, further development and a strong connection within the group.

Language stay for our two apprentices in Malta

Two of our apprentices were given the opportunity to take part in a language study trip to Malta through the ERASMUS programme. They stayed at the Sapphire House and immediately felt at home. At the language school, they were divided into different classes and enjoyed varied and motivating lessons. A group project about Malta brought them into contact with locals and strengthened their English skills.

The leisure programme also offered plenty of variety: they were particularly enthusiastic about laser tag in the old prison, the escape room, the cooking class with Maltese pizza and the scavenger hunt in Mdina. In their free time, they explored Valletta, visited the market in Marsaxlokk and enjoyed swimming in St. Peter's Pool and the impressively clear Blue Lagoon.

Our apprentices returned with many new impressions, improved language skills and unforgettable memories. An all-round successful stay.
